Post Wheel size question for 1973 911T

What are the widest wheel / tire combination that can be safetly used on a 1973 911T with out hitting fenderwells or requiring body work?

7-inch in rear and 6-inch in front. You can cheat it a tiny bit further with 944 Turbo Fuchs, which have a different offset, and allow 8-inch in back and 7-inch in front. The 944 Turbo wheels are hard to find.

Tire-wise, I think 225 is as wide as anyone fits in front (and not everyone can do that, even with the fender lips rolled up flush with the insides of the fenders. In back -- well, I don't recall. I put SC flares in the back of my 73.
